Wavelength Range 190 to 900 nm
Spectral Bandwidth 0.2 nm, 0.4 nm, 0.7 nm, 1.4 nm, 2.4 nm, 5.0 nm
Wavelength Accuracy ≤ ± 0.5 nm
Wavelength Repeatability ≤ 0.3 nm (single direction)
Baseline Drift ± 0.004 Abs / 30 min
Resolution ≤40 %
Characteristic Concentration (Cu) ≤ 0.04 µg / ml / 1 %
Detection Limit (Cu) ≤0.08 µg/ml
Background Calibration Ability Greater than 30 times
RS232 Including
Printer Optional
Power Consumption 200W
Power Supply 220V / 3A, 50 Hz
Dimension 1250 × 795 × 765 mm
Weight 138 Kg

Atomic Absorption Spectrophotometer LAAS-A25 FAQ's
  • An analytical tool called an Atomic Absorption Spectrophotometer (AAS) uses the light that each element's atom absorbs to determine the concentration of that element in a sample.

  • The basis of spectrophotometry is the light uptake by unbound atoms in a gaseous state. An excited state is created when atoms in the ground state absorb light energy at particular wavelengths. Analyte content in the sample can be calculated by determining the amount of light consumed.

  • The components include an atomizer (commonly used atomizers are Flame atomizers and Electro thermal atomizers), a Radiation source, and a spectrophotometer.

  • The hollow cathode lamp in atomic absorption spectrophotometer emits distinctive light at particular wavelengths that match the target analyte. This guarantees that the analyte atoms are excited selectively, resulting in exact and reliable readings.
